VICTORIA AND ANNEXATION. Melbourne, January 13.
At crowded meetings which have been held at Geelong, (Sandhurst, and other townb in this colony, resolutions have boen passed similar to those adopted at the meetings hold iii tko Town Hall in this city and at Ballarat, urging the annexation by Great Britain of tho Webtorn Pacific Jblands, and advocating tho removal of Lord Derby from office.
